IP查询
查询
你查询的IP:[119.144.70.136] 地理位置:中国–广东–东莞
最新查询
202.127.160.160
221.176.177.137
118.102.16.238
119.18.224.173
60.194.230.133
124.72.218.137
118.24.146.179
118.89.215.213
125.171.155.137
119.144.70.136
124.240.122.238
118.24.13.145
116.242.1.17
202.92.95.22
202.122.32.10
122.136.91.132
119.27.64.9
123.138.42.164
121.48.10.20
116.70.146.101
124.240.128.106
203.191.16.18
202.152.176.63
59.32.231.135
202.124.24.252
117.76.15.67
119.88.180.215
202.22.248.108
162.105.147.165
117.48.47.73
202.93.160.38